Chalak in Detail

1 of 7) چالاک : Cagey Cagy Canny Clever : (satellite adjective) showing self-interest and shrewdness in dealing with others.

3 of 7) چالاک فریبی پر تدبیر : Devious Shifty : (satellite adjective) characterized by insincerity or deceit; evasive.

4 of 7) چالاک ہوشیاری ہوش مند : Clever Cunning Ingenious : (satellite adjective) showing inventiveness and skill.

5 of 7) ذہین چالاک تیز ذہن : Agile Nimble : (satellite adjective) mentally quick.

6 of 7) چالاک : Arch : (satellite adjective) expert in skulduggery.

7 of 7) عیار چالاک : Artful : (adjective) marked by skill in achieving a desired end especially with cunning or craft.
